Why Can 18-Wheelers Cause Serious Damages?

Accidents involving 18-wheelers, also known as tractor-trailers or big rigs, tend to be more serious for several reasons according to an 18 wheeler accident lawyer with our friends at Kiefer & Kiefer:

  1. Size and Weight: 18-wheelers are significantly larger and heavier than most other vehicles on the road. A fully loaded tractor-trailer can weigh up to 80,000 pounds, while the average passenger car weighs around 4,000 pounds. The sheer mass and momentum of a tractor-trailer make collisions with smaller vehicles especially devastating.
  2. Increased Stopping Distance: Due to their size and weight, 18-wheelers have a longer stopping distance. This means that they require more time and distance to come to a complete stop, which can result in rear-end collisions or an inability to avoid obstacles on the road.
  3. Limited Maneuverability: Tractor-trailers are less maneuverable than smaller vehicles. They have a wider turning radius and may have difficulty navigating tight corners or avoiding hazards. This limited maneuverability can contribute to accidents in certain situations.
  4. Driver Fatigue: Long-haul truck drivers often face demanding schedules and spend extended hours on the road. Fatigue can lead to reduced alertness and slower reaction times, increasing the risk of accidents.
  5. Blind Spots: 18-wheelers have large blind spots, especially on the right side and directly behind the trailer. Smaller vehicles that linger in these blind spots may go unnoticed by the truck driver, increasing the potential for collisions.
  6. Mechanical Issues: Mechanical failures in large trucks, such as brake malfunctions or tire blowouts, can lead to accidents. Regular maintenance and safety checks are essential to prevent such issues.
  7. Cargo Spills: When an 18-wheeler is involved in an accident, the cargo it’s carrying can spill onto the road, creating additional hazards and causing more extensive damage.
  8. High Speeds: Tractor-trailers are often driven at high speeds on highways and interstates. When accidents occur at high speeds, the force of impact is more significant, leading to more severe injuries and damage.
  9. Inexperienced or Inattentive Drivers: Some truck drivers may lack experience or engage in distracted or reckless driving behaviors, increasing the risk of accidents.
  10. Jackknifing: Jackknifing is a dangerous situation where the trailer of an 18-wheeler swings outward, causing the truck to fold into a V-shape. This can occur during hard braking or sharp turns and often leads to serious accidents.

Accidents with large commercial trucks can result in severe injuries, significant property damage, and even fatalities due to the sheer size and weight of these vehicles. Truck accidents often involve multiple parties, including the truck driver, the trucking company, and potentially other third parties, such as maintenance providers or cargo loaders. An experienced lawyer will investigate the accident thoroughly, identify liable parties, and determine the cause, which may involve factors like driver fatigue, mechanical failures, or regulatory violations.

Additionally, trucking companies often have insurance teams and legal counsel to protect their interests. Having your own attorney levels the playing field and ensures that your rights are safeguarded throughout the negotiation or litigation process.

Moreover, trucking regulations are extensive and complex, with federal and state laws governing various aspects of the industry. A knowledgeable attorney will understand these regulations and how they apply to your case, ensuring that all relevant laws are followed.
